POI : Volcanism Type : Fumaroles Name : Sulphur Dioxide Fumaroles First discovered for ExTool : padremo | Fumaroles are gaps in a planet's crust through which gases and steam are emitted. The ejected material often accumulates around the opening. A surface opening that emits high-pressure gas and minerals, found on terrestrial planets with sulphur dioxide magma. |
